„Cyberdefenders“ is an innovative educational game designed for children, created in collaboration between Markenfilm SPACE, the European Publication Office, and Europol. Developed for the immersive platform Roblox, this engaging experience leaves young players with essential knowledge about the dangers of cybercrime and teaches them to protect themselves online.

Game development
The challenge was to find good ways to make critical online safety topics—such as online robbery, child grooming, and identity theft—engaging and accessible for children. We found creative ways to present these sensitive subjects in a playful yet educational format emphasizing the importance of online safety. We developed three unique levels, each designed to focus on one of the key topics. Players navigate through the game, learning important lessons in a hands-on way. They are rewarded with stars and gadgets as they progress.
Understanding the Metaverse
The project initially started with a feasibility study on metaverse solutions—diverse virtual platforms where users engage through avatars in immersive digital environments. Europol tasked us with exploring how these platforms could be utilized to educate children about online safety, positioning them as protectors in the digital world. This study laid the foundation for a concept designed to teach young users about the risks of the internet while emphasizing Europol’s role in safeguarding them across various virtual spaces.
Finding a platform for the learning objective
The study revealed that it was essential to choose a platform that was both widely popular among children and capable of delivering immersive, interactive experiences. Roblox emerged as the ideal choice due to its widespread appeal and accessibility. As a platform, it offers endless user-generated worlds playable across nearly any device, from smartphones and tablets to computers and gaming consoles. Its compatibility with virtual reality (VR) further enhances its immersive nature, making it a favorite among young audiences. By creating our game on Roblox, we leverage a platform children are already familiar with, ensuring they can easily engage in a fun, interactive environment while learning critical lessons about online safety.
Developing the Game in Roblox Studio
Once the concept was finalized, we began building the game in Roblox Studio, using Lua as the core programming language. Our team translated the ideas from storyboards into a fully interactive game, modeling the virtual world based on our initial drafts and KI generated images. We designed custom assets, from gadgets, assets and rewards to in-game houses, creating a playful yet realistic environment. One of the key elements was the Europol station, which we modeled to resemble the real-life headquarters, ensuring the game felt authentic while immersing players in a fun, educational experience.
